JAMSHEDPUR – Motilal Nehru Public School (MNPS) celebrated India’s 77th Independence Day on August 15, showcasing a love for the nation.
Secretary Dr. DP Shukla praised children and teachers and spoke about joy, love, respect for the nation, emphasizing the values of unity, freedom, and peace.
The school choir sang "Yeh Desh Meri Jaan Hai" to display patriotism.
Nursery children delivered patriotic songs, and Junior and High School performed dancing routines to celebrate the nation’s heritage.
Pre-primary children sang the National Anthem after the flag presentation, uniting the school in pride.
Earlier, General Secretary Dr. D P Shukla and Principal Ashu Tiwary raised the National Flag as the event began.
